What is jupyter-mcp-server?

jupyter-mcp-server is 🪐 🔧 Model Context Protocol (MCP) Server for Jupyter.. It is categorized as a MCP Server with 1.1k GitHub stars.

What programming language is jupyter-mcp-server written in?

jupyter-mcp-server is primarily written in Python. It covers topics such as ai, jupyter, mcp.
